摘要:筛管完井的水平并一般水平段套管外没有固井,常规找堵水工具的应用受到限制,中原油图在云2平4并开展了水平井定向措水技术的相关研究。采用K344专用对隔器卡时预定层段,将高性能堵制化学时隔器(ACP)定向置放,实现无固井段套管外的地层分隔,然后采用K344专用封隔器验证化学封隔器(ACP)的封堵效果;最后采用专用插管封隔器,向地层挤入较大制量高性能堵制(ZR-PD),达到时堵水平并出水层段的的。现场施工结果表明,堵水后平均日增油3.7t,含水下降4.5 个百分点;截至2015年底,阶段累计增油1023.6t,累计降液22983m,阶段有效期398d。水平井定向堵水的针对性强,工艺成功率高,增油降水效果明显。
关键词:水平井;筛管完井;环空化学封隔器;胶束微膜堵剂;定向堵水;中原油田

Abstract: Cementation is usually not conducted outside the casing in horizontal section of a horizontal well completed by screen pipc, and the application of conventional water detection and shutoff tools is restricted. In this regard, the horizontal well directional water plugging technology was discussed for its applicability in Well Y2-P4 in the Zhongyuan Oilfield. Special K344 packer was used to seal the pre-determined section, and the high performance plugging agent annular chemical packer (ACP) was placed directionally to realize separation of formation outside the casing that was not cemented. Then, special K344 packer was used to verify the plugging effect of the ACP. Finally, special bayonet-tube packer was used to inject large volume of high performance plugging agent (ZR-PD) into the formation, so as to achieve the plugging of water-producing interval of horizontal scction. Field application shows that, after water plugging, the average daily incremental oil was 3.7 t, and the water cut dropped by 4.5%. By the end of 2015, the interim total incremental oil was 1 023.6 t, the total decremental fluid was 22 983 m', and the interim effective period was 398 d. The horizontal well directional water plugging technology is highly specific to certain application, and it can realize high success and apparent oil increasing and water decreasing effect.
Key words: horizontal well; screen completion; annular chemical packer; micelles microfilm plugging ageint; directional water plugging; Zhongyuan Oilfield
